11 killed, over 100 injured as 6.5 quake rattles Pakistan, Afghanistan: Updates

A magnitude 6.5 earthquake struck Pakistan and Afghanistan on Tuesday, panicking residents who were seen fleeing from home and offices. At least 11 people died in Afghanistan and Pakistan, Associated Press reported. Read more

‘I want to take revenge of 2011…’: Shoaib Akhtar’s big India-Pakistan prediction for 2023 World Cup, Asia Cup

There is still no clarity on whether India will travel to Pakistan for the Asia Cup 2023 in September. If they don’t, the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B) have threatened a pullout from the ODI World Cup slated to take place in India a month later. Read more
